{"data":{"id":"us-ca/prc-4626","jurisdiction":"us-ca","citation":"PRC § 4626","heading":"","body":"If at any time the board finds that the applicant has failed to conform to the intent to convert, as set forth in the application and proof, the board may revoke the permit and require full compliance with this chapter. Any permit revocation shall be recorded in the same manner as the original permit.","path":["Public Resources Code - PRC","DIVISION 4.
